Hi All,

Roughly once every 30-40 starts, my Volvo will experience one of the following issues (see attached videos):

1. The tachometer will spike up to 3000 to 4000 rpm, go back to 0 rpm, and then normalize at 1000 rpm. When this occurs, the start is otherwise normal

2. A sluggish start where the engine will crank and the tachometer will bounce between 0 and 500 rpm for 3 to 4 seconds until the engine finally starts up.

No issues while driving. Any thoughts?
